KMC issues 24-hour ultimatum to Norvic Hospital to remove illegal structures



KATHMANDU: Kathmandu Metropolitan City (KMC) has given a 24-hour ultimatum to Norvic International Hospital to remove the structures the hospital has built against the rules.

KMC Mayor Balendra Shah said that if the canteen and other structures of the hospital are not removed within 24 hours, contrary to the agreement with the Government of Nepal, action will be taken.

A 24-hour ultimatum has been issued to the hospital to demolish the structure on the land leased by the hospital, which is registered in the name of the KMC.
